
“How can you dance while everybody is worried about this summer? All the rivers are drying up, and our lives are in danger,” the elephant rumbled, watching the frog’s joyful leaps.
“Stop worrying, dear friend,” the frog chirped, its eyes bright. “It’s going to rain. You know, the frogs are always the first to sense the coming rain.”
“Wow, are you truly saying it’s going to rain soon?” the elephant asked, a glimmer of hope in its eyes. “Then I will certainly join your dance!”
Soon, the word spread, and one by one, all the worried animals began to move with the little frog. They swayed and hopped, their anxieties momentarily forgotten in the shared anticipation. And then, as if on cue, the first fat drops of rain began to fall, quickly turning into a life-giving downpour.
